**Action item (owner: on-call rotation, Kestrelwing team).** During incident review we confirmed that enabling permessage-deflate on the Hollybrae websocket tier cut egress by roughly 60% but raised p99 CPU enough to trigger autoscale flapping under burst. We are keeping compression on, with a per-connection size threshold and a shared-window cap so small frames skip compression entirely. If you see CPU alarms on this tier, check these values first before toggling the feature flag. The current settings are given below.

tuning constants:
QUOTAS = {
    "druwyn": 5,
    "holix": 5,
    "zorath": 5,
    "holwyn": 10,
}

Action item (from the Bramford matcher incident): reviewer, please verify that the revised heap settings actually bound pause times under the replayed peak-load trace, not just the synthetic benchmark. Previous tuning hid multi-second pauses behind averaged metrics. Confirm each value against the incident timeline before approving. The proposed constants are as follows.

constants for tageg-kagag:
QUOTAS = {
    "kelax": 495,
    "istath": 366,
    "tammir": 108,
    "novdor": 730,
    "casax": 816,
    "quenael": 874,
    "pelius": 403,
}

## Step 4: Warm-up settings

Move the Lanternjob handlers to provisioned concurrency before cutting DNS. Cold starts exceeded the upstream timeout during the last rehearsal; do not skip this. Verify the warm pool is healthy in the Dravik console, then apply the settings below. These are the values to apply.

service settings:
[pelys]
team = druys
access_code = ac_54772a
host = pelys.halixnet.corp
port = 9200
owner = noveth.kelax
peer = ralius.ferradata.corp